Kiss and Drop explained and safety tips

The Kiss and Drop Zone is an area near the school gates that enables you to drop your child off safely and quickly. The intention is that drivers do not wait in these zones and that they stay in the vehicle so that drop off is streamlined and traffic queues are minimised. Maximum of 2 minutes in the kiss & drop zone.

Yamba Public School has only 2 car bays in the Kiss and Drop Zone. The Kiss and Drop Zone is located at the far end of the Bus Zone between the white and red signs.

We want to ensure that no child is hit by a car when going to and coming from school. You need to take extra care when driving and parking around school zones. Make sure you and your child understand the road rules. If you break the traffic rules in a school zone you are putting children at risk.

Yamba Public School's Policy in consultation with Clarence Valley Council: 

  • Kiss and Drop Zone is a "No Parking" area.
  • Move entirely into and to the extreme end of the bay, be aware that there is only 2 Kiss and Drop bays. A maximum of 2 minutes in Kiss &Drop zone, if there is no available space continue out and park in the southern car parking bays or Service Road across from the school.
  • Drivers should remain in their vehicles and all times.
  • When you leave home ensure children are in their seats with their bags with them. Bags should not be in the back of the car unless you are parking in the designated parking areas.
  • Make sure children use the footpath side of the door when getting in and out of the car.
  • Do not park or drop off in the Bus Zone at anytime. As it can hold up the bus and traffic flow.
  • Never double park.
  • If the Kiss and Drop Zone is full or you wish to get out of the car, drive to the 8 car parking bays further up. Or park on the other side of Angourie Road.
  • When crossing Angourie Road, please use the crossing, we need to set good examples for our children.
  • Consider not using the Kiss and Drop if your child is not capable of getting out of the car themselves.
  • Do not park in Staff Car Park.

Please be respectful of other drivers, children and volunteers.
